A splendid culinary adventure awaits you at Navarre, a unique dining destination with a highly innovative take on the working of a restaurant. The interiors have a very casual, cafe-style vibe with bare walls, a wine shelf on one of the walls and a handful of lanterns hanging from the ceiling. The all-glass entrance allows a good play of natural light inside. The chef crafts an innovative selection of European small plates with influences from the Italian, French and Spanish palate. They do an amazing brunch but their dinners are just completely out of this world! They have a dinner Tasting Menu that is $45/ person with about 10 dishes, that is beyond amazing! Farm to Table Tapas Style Menu: 🇵🇹 Portuguese 🇮🇹 Italian 🇪🇸 Spanish 🇫🇷 French
Amazing! The Ken’s bread with French butter and Marionberry jam was so good! I had a corn, goat cheese tarragon omelette, it was so tender and flavorful! Derek had the coppa eggs Benedict and it was fantastic! I’ll be back for the bitter chocolate mousse for sure! Francine, our server was great, as well!
The tapas style plates were all delicious and I look forward to our next tasty visit! The wait staff was fantastic and very helpful in explaining the menu! Very different from any place I’ve eaten in Portland! Lamb was so tender and savory!
A lovely gem of a restaurant, the food was amazing. The herbed carrots were just the right consistency tender but firm. The duck confit in cherry mutard was divine, and I love the portion options on every menu item.
Unpretentious, straightforward, precise cooking of regional fare. I loved it
Unique dining experience that you kind of build yourself—or let them serve you their own inspired meal. Definitely recommend.
Delicious food, easy ordering system. You can have little tastes of all the dishes. Try the radishes with butter! And the bread is fantastic They sell wine, beer, soda, hot coffee and hot tea. No liquor and no cocktails.
